General information:
| Mission Statement: |
The overall mission of our institution is to provide prime education and training to our students, which will enable them to successfully pass their state board exam, obtain licensure and become successfully employed in the salon industry.The instructional staff possesses the skills required to provide necessary training, and we aspire to produce capable, productive stylists and/or nail technicians that exhibit the determination, skills, ability and the desire to succeed in the salon environment.Each student will not only receive instruction and exposure to essential technical skills and equiptment, but also the opportunity for hands on, supervised work with the public.Specifically, the objectives of the programs are:* to build a solid foundation of education and technical skills* to provide exposure to the role of the professional cosmetologist/nail tech, including opportunities for supervised practical hands on work* to offer students an opportunity for exposure to up-to-date products and styling techniques* to teach our students the components of the proper attitude that a professional cosmetologist/nail tech should have* to motivate our students to develop all of their artistic talent* to teach our students good industry ethics and sound business practices* to fulfill all state board requirements |
